Fixes an import error when using S3/Minio with no redis (#1224)

## Context

Error is caused due to these steps:
- File is uploaded to Home server and attempts to import
- Import ends up in `claimDocument` in `HostedStorageManager`
- Tries to read doc metadata from DocWorkerMap, gets 'unknown' as md5 hash
- Thinks local doc is out of date and erases it.
- Downloads a non-existent file from S3, so import fails as it has no data.

## Proposed solution

This fixes it by checking for DummyDocWorker's special 'unknown' MD5, forcing an S3 check.
